Output e62a95ca26757c411db11674525e429b51f3caf8b11069fd7aab1ef2d99a3e16:1

value
3517716
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69377463fad94d20c8821fbd10c3570b8b5e7b14 OP_EQUALVERIFY OP_CHECKSIG
address
1AbLPCXyqNczosEGYvd9y75PZwp8xCvQxi
transaction
e62a95ca26757c411db11674525e429b51f3caf8b11069fd7aab1ef2d99a3e16
confirmations
395389
spent
true